Woodward Charitable Trust: Playschemes
The Woodward Charitable Trust is a grant-making trust and is one of the Sainsbury Family Charitable Trusts. Each year the trustees of the Woodward Charitable Trust set aside funds for summer playschemes for children between the ages of 5-16 years. Most grants awarded are in the range of £500 to £1,000. Around 35 grants are made each year.

Scheme details
This scheme is only for playschemes that run for a minimum of 2 weeks or 10 days across the summer holidays.

NB Grants can only be paid to registered charities. If you are not a registered charity, please give full name and address of a registered charity who has agreed to accept a grant on your behalf. Please note they will need a copy of their most recent audited accounts.

Preference is given to:
small local playschemes that provide a wide-ranging programme of activities
schemes that involve a large number of children
schemes catering for those from disadvantaged backgrounds or that have a disability
schemes that are inclusive such as projects that work with children from a range of backgrounds, abilities and race
schemes where past users are encouraged to come back and help as volunteers

Exclusions
Trustees DO NOT fund:

trips that are only social. Trustees prefer to fund trips that are educational and motivational.
charities whose annual turnover exceeds £100,000
overseas projects
playgroups
individuals in any capacity
educational fees
